What Is The Cost Difference Between Conventional Therapy And BetterHelp? 

Forbes reports that the average price of an in-person therapy session in the US is $100 to $200 per hour. These prices may be higher in Payne due to a higher cost of living.

Some therapists in the state of Ohio may work on a sliding scale, meaning they'll factor in your income and charge what you can afford per session. With BetterHelp therapists serving the city of Payne and elsewhere throughout the state of Ohio you can expect significantly more affordable options, with sessions ranging from $60 to $90 per week (billed every four weeks).

Emergency Situations

If you are experiencing a crisis or emergency, don't use this site's online services. If you are in life-threatening danger, call 911. If you require support for a crisis, reach out to the hotlines below:

·      National Domestic Violence Hotline: 1-800-799-SAFE (7233)

·      National Suicide Prevention Lifeline: 1-800-273-TALK (8255)

·      Crisis Text Line: Text HOME to 741741

·      Veterans Crisis Line: Call 1-800-273-8255 (and press 1) or text 838255. For support for the deaf and hard of hearing community, please use your preferred relay service or dial 711 then 1-800-273-8255.

·      Trevor Lifeline (LGBTQ Lifeline): (866)488-7386 

·      SAMHSA National Helpline (Substance Use): (800)662-4357

·      National Eating Disorder Association Helpline:1-800-931-2237 (M-Th: 9 AM-9 PM EST, Fri 9 AM - 5 PM EST)

·      Child Help Hotline: Call 1-800-422-4453 or use the online chat feature

·      National Anti-Hazing Hotline: 1-888-NOT-HAZE (1-888-668-4293) 

·      Physician Crisis Support Line: Call 1-888-409-0141 if you are a first responder or medical provider experiencing crises related to Covid-19

·      Sexual Assault Hotline: Call RAINN at 1-800-656-4673

How Do I See A Therapist For The First Time? 

Before seeing your therapist, prep for your session by reading about the counseling process. You might write a list of questions you want to ask your therapist. When you attend your session, let them know if you have any concerns about therapy or feel unsure about what to talk about. They may help guide you with open-ended therapeutic questions. The first session will often serve as an intake to get to know you as a person and why you're attending therapy.

Do Therapists Judge You? 

The boundaries between you and a therapist are in place to protect you and them from ethical concerns. Therapists are held by ethical standards through the American Psychological Association (APA) and are not allowed to judge or harm their clients. Their job is to support you and make you feel safe and respected. You might consider changing therapists if you don't feel safe or respected.
